ABSTRACT In this letter, a new coupling configuration of the stepped-impedance resonator (SIR) has been presented to design dual-passband filters with the small circuit size. We design the filter with higher selectivity based on SIR direct-coupling, input, and output external quality factors. Through resonance characteristics of a SIR, the second resonant frequency can be tuned by adjusting structure parameters. The agreement between measured results and full-wave simulation prediction validates the feasible configuration of the proposed filters. © 2013 Wiley Periodicals, Inc.
